# Export retry config for the Mirevale reporting pipeline.
# Failed exports to the Ostrell warehouse are retried with
# exponential backoff; EXPORT_RETRY_MAX=5 and EXPORT_RETRY_BASE_MS=2000
# are the reviewed defaults. Do not raise retries above 8 or the
# nightly window overruns. The retry worker authenticates to the
# warehouse on each attempt, so its credential must live in this
# file. It belongs on the line immediately following this comment block.

vault entry, yahif-yajep: COURIER_KEY29=b802bdf8034096b65a51c6ba5abe2

## Releases

Version 3.1 fixes the memory leak in the Bramblewood image cache, where evicted thumbnails kept references through the decode pool. New team members cutting a release: run the soak test overnight and confirm resident memory stays flat before tagging. Changelog entries go in NOTES.md; keep them short. Release artifacts must be signed before upload or the Fenwick registry rejects them. Sign with the release key shown below.

rollout seal: bky4_x7Gc

## Further reading

The Squatterel scanner checks every new dependency against our registry allowlist and flags names within edit distance two of popular packages. Alerts route to the on-call channel; false positives should be tagged, not silenced, so the model improves. Triage guidance, alert severity definitions, and the suppression workflow are documented here.

runbook for badug-kadup: https://confluence.zemvarlabs.internal/projects/browse/display/projects/bd1b

## Onboarding: Cron Migration to Tidewheel

We are moving all legacy cron jobs from the Harrowgate batch hosts onto the Tidewheel workflow engine. For security review purposes, note that each migrated job runs under a dedicated service account with scoped grants, replacing the shared `batchops` user. Secrets are injected at runtime from the vault sidecar rather than stored in crontabs. Audit logs for every run land in the `wf_audit` schema. To inspect that schema, connect with the read-only credentials in the string below.

primary connection of yagep-kahip = redis://giliel_svc:zYiKsLL2PLpfPL@db-348f.xolmarsys.corp:5432/fenwyn